Philadelphia Phillies Extend Manager Rob Thomsons Contract, Showing Confidence in His LeadershipThe Philadelphia Phillies have made a significant move by extending manager Rob Thomsons contract through the 2027 season, ending speculation about his job security. Thomson, who took over midway through the 2022 season, has led the team to the playoffs in all four of his seasons, securing back-to-back National League East division titles.
